DANCE PARTY TO CELEBRATE COMING-OF-AGE
BIRTHDAY CARNIVAL AT POINT ERIN KIOSK
MISS NOTA CASEY A number of young people were entertained at a very jolly dance party at Point Erin Tea Kiosk on Wednesday evening, given by Mr. W. Casey to celebrate the coming-of-age of his daughter Nota. The dance room was attractively decorated with hanging baskets of ferns and tall bamboo plants. Supper was served on the verandah, the tables being decorated with larkspur of various shades. Music was supplied by Mr. George Wade’s orchestra. Mrs. Casey received the guests wearing a frock of bois de rose crepe de chine and lace, assisted by Miss Ima Casey in flame georgette and gold rose spray. Miss Nota Casey wore a model frock of pervenche blue georgette. AMONG THE GUESTS Mrs. IT. McCay wore gold lace and amber taffeta. Mrs. R. Newcombe was in cameo pink georgette, with frilled skirt.
